Transaction 874f331ece1769189f12c58d5e525db9ef6ea1620e1b0a6df12afb2385a0d796
1 Input
1 Output
-
874f331ece1769189f12c58d5e525db9ef6ea1620e1b0a6df12afb2385a0d796:0
- value
- 6999334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b821af536b1c520d080f6ba6ba03b22c10004f1f OP_EQUAL
- address
- 3JUccJi2GDeZQAK4bgNX2HNaWLcMYGaE53